Russia goes on 4-game winning spree at 2014 Ice Hockey World Championship

The Russian national hockey squad, led by its new Head Coach Oleg Znarok and captained by NHL Washington Capitals forward Alexander Ovechkin, is solidly topping its Group B

MOSCOW, May 15. /ITAR-TASS/. Haunted by poor performances in the recent years, the Russian machine seems to be back on its track going for the confident four-game winning spree at the 2014 Ice Hockey World Championship, held in the Belarusian capital of Minsk from May 9 to 25.
